Mimics
The act of copying or imitating movements, speech, behavior, or sounds, often for learning or social interaction.
Visual Tracking
The ability to smoothly follow a moving object with one's gaze, crucial for various tasks and developing in early childhood.
Preferential Looking
A research technique used to study visual attention and perception, especially in infants, by measuring how long they look at one stimulus compared to another.
Brain Imaging
Techniques and processes used to visualize the structure or function of the brain through various forms of imaging technology.
